STEVENS POINT'S NO. 1 DOUBLES TEAM QUALIFIES FOR STATE GIRLS TENNIS MEET

Zaleski Sports
EAU CLAIRE – The Stevens Point No. 1 doubles team of Abby Erwin and Tatum Thielman is going to state after finishing third at the WIAA Division 1 girls tennis sectional on Wednesday at the Menards Tennis Center.
The top four finishers in No. 1 singles and No. 1 doubles, and the top finisher in No. 2 singles and No. 2 doubles automatically qualify for the 2021 WIAA Individual State Girls Tennis Tournament on Oct. 14-16 at Nielsen Tennis Stadium in Madison. Up to 16 additional qualifiers may be added in the No. 1 flights, which will be announced Thursday or Friday.
No. 3 and No. 4 flights were competed strictly for team points. Hudson won the sectional title with 49 points to qualify for the 2021 WIAA Team State Girls Tennis Tournament in Madison on Oct. 22-23. Stevens Point finished fourth with 19 points.
Erwin and Thielman won their first match to qualify for state. They lost in the semifinals before defeated Brogan O’Flanagan and Rhea Warner of New Richmond 5-7, 6-3, 6-4, to finish third.
Jessica Kleman lost her first match at No. 1 singles to Izzy Brinkman of New Richmond 6-2, 6-0; Addison Jandrain lost both of her matches to finish fourth at No. 4 singles; and the No. 2 doubles team of Carolina Blakeman and Berit Borgnes finished second, losing in the finals to Jordan Yacoub and Bailey Finch of Hudson 6-0, 6-4, for SPASH.
Wisconsin Rapids’ No. 1 doubles team of Teagann Bondioli and Abbey Gust lost its first match to Kira Young and Grace Lewis of Hudson 6-0, 6-1.
Marshfield’s lone sectional qualifier, the No. 3 doubles team of Sam Ridgway and Danielle Minsaas, lost in the semifinals before winning the third-place match over Lilly Wittwer and Kaydee Rennie of Wausau West 4-6, 7-5, 6-2.
